This exclusive overview of Stefan Milkov's art from the 1980s to the present offers readers a view of his sculptural work and large-scale abstract paintings, which he has been working on intensively for the last ten years.
This book is linked to the exhibition of the same name at DOX Centre for Contemporary Art, but its scope exceeds it. It includes an extensive interview between the artist and curator Leoš Válka, in which Stefan Milkov reveals his artistic formation, family roots, cultural influences, talks about his studies during the totalitarian era and reflects on more general topics such as commitment, the relationship between art and the market, and the development of artificial intelligence. A deep reflection of the artist's work is presented in an essay by sculptor and former artistic colleague Jaroslav Róna, who together with Milkov helped found the artistic group Tvrdohlaví (1987–2001).
The book reflects Milkov's artistic evolution as well as the various positions of his work, from his engagement with mythical symbols and biblical stories to his interest in technological elegance pointing to the machine age.
